Overview

This contract is for a supplier to conduct of surveys to understand stakeholder perceptions of Ofgem and the duties that it carries out such as the energy transition. Ofgem requires the support of stakeholders to deliver its objectives and as part of this, the organisation needs to understand how stakeholders perceive Ofgem and the work it does. The energy market is becoming increasingly dynamic and continues to evolve, set against a backdrop of political change. Ofgem must respond at pace to these challenges.
